Jane Clarke was transported on the Caroline, departing 15th Apr 1833 and arriving 6th Aug 1833 with 122 passengers.

Departed Cove with 120 females from Cork and the surrounding various gaols - also on board were 56 free settlers along with their women and children. wed april 3 1833 .

Irish Convict Database, by Peter Mayberry. Jane Clarke, alias Clark, age on arrival, 25, arrived per Caroline, (1833) Tried 1832 at Cavan, 7 years, for Robbery house. DOB 1808, native place, Meath Co, Single. Catholic. Trade, Dairy maid all work.
